Transaction 289615d8afd64ec47756b3e3f5747f13c4e86d71793623ee2eb436733d034a73

1 Input
1 Outputs
  • 289615d8afd64ec47756b3e3f5747f13c4e86d71793623ee2eb436733d034a73:0
  • value  4421404
    address  1FMrKyGiPHRVcQVESticWU9NGCL2UagXYx